Steel Fabrication Operations Manager Location: Gallaway, TN Job Type: Direct Hire Starting Salary: $80,000/year; higher salary may be available depending on experience Position Overview We are seeking an experienced Steel Fabrication Operations Manager to lead production across two nearby facilities operating on two shifts. This position oversees production supervisors and is accountable for safety, equipment and facility upkeep, productivity, quality, scheduling, and on-time deliveries . The ideal candidate has a strong structural steel fabrication background, experience with AISC and AWS standards , knowledge of coating requirements, and a hands-on approach to leading production teams and managing multiple projects. Key Responsibilities Direct daily fabrication activities across both facilities and shifts. Lead approximately 65 employees , with planned growth toward 90, including 5–6 department/shop supervisors. Establish priorities and coordinate production schedules to meet shipping and delivery requirements. Promote safe work practices and ensure proper facility and equipment maintenance. Monitor fabrication efficiency, quality, and workflow across departments. Provide leadership in Receiving/Inventory, CNC Processing, Fabrication/Welding, Paint, and Shipping . Support hiring, employee retention, workforce development, disciplinary matters, and succession planning. Identify opportunities to improve production processes, quality, safety, and overall efficiency. Manage multiple complex fabrication projects and anticipate potential production issues. Work closely with operations leadership on scheduling, staffing, and continuous improvement initiatives. Perform other duties as assigned. Qualifications 7+ years of structural steel fabrication experience. 5+ years of leadership experience in fabrication, manufacturing, or production. Strong knowledge of AWS D1.1 ; CWI certification preferred but not required. Experience working in an AISC-certified fabrication shop or environment. Background managing large, heavy, and complex steel fabrication projects . Knowledge of SSPC and ASTM coating requirements . Understanding of structural steel fabrication processes, workflows, and shop practices. Experience managing multiple production departments. Strong communication, organization, leadership, and problem-solving abilities. Ability to identify potential issues and opportunities for improvement before they impact production.
